Improve Throughput Without Letting Shelving Become a Bottleneck

Well-planned shelving helps employees move from receiving to storage, picking, replenishment, and dispatch with fewer unnecessary touches. Each zone can be assigned according to inventory velocity, item size, work sequence, and the teams that need access.

Connect Receiving, Reserve Storage, and Forward Pick Areas

Fast-moving products can be placed in accessible pick locations while reserve quantities remain nearby for replenishment. This reduces the need to search through bulk cartons or travel across unrelated departments for routine restocking.

Keep Docks and Staging Lanes Available for Active Work

When cartons, returns, and project materials have assigned shelf locations, receiving and outbound areas are less likely to become long-term storage. Open staging space supports inspection, sorting, transfer, and shipping activity.

Create Repeatable Locations for High-SKU Inventory

Consistent bays, shelf levels, bins, and labels make small products easier to identify and count. Defined locations also help new employees follow the same pick path instead of relying on individual memory.

Add Capacity in Manageable Modules

Adjustable shelving bays can be expanded or reconfigured as contracts, seasonal volume, parts programs, or product lines change. Modular growth can reduce the disruption of rebuilding an entire storage room at once.

Warehouse Shelving Systems for Joliet Facilities

The appropriate system depends on product dimensions, weight, handling method, environment, access frequency, and published capacity. JC Installations Services LLC installs new commercial shelving and can review customer-supplied components for assembly or relocation when the parts are identifiable, compatible, complete, undamaged, and suitable for the approved configuration.

Wide-Span Shelving for Large Cartons and Hand-Loaded Cases

Wide-span units provide longer openings for boxed equipment, large cases, kits, and irregular items that are loaded by hand. They are useful when standard shelving is too narrow but pallet rack is not the right fit for the product or workflow.

Boltless Shelving for Flexible SKU and Supply Storage

Rivet or boltless shelving offers adjustable shelf spacing for cartons, totes, packaged products, consumables, and general stock. Shelf elevations can be revised when product dimensions or inventory quantities change.

Steel Shelving for Parts, Tools, and MRO Inventory

Open or closed steel shelving can be organized with bins, dividers, and labels for fasteners, repair components, tools, electrical items, and maintenance supplies. Defined compartments help similar inventory remain separated and countable.

Wire Shelving for Visible Supplies and Clean Backroom Storage

Wire shelves provide open visibility and airflow for supply rooms, retail backstock, packaged materials, and frequently checked inventory. The open construction makes visual checks easier when shelf locations remain labeled and orderly.

Mobile Shelving for Dense Records or Controlled Inventory

Mobile systems reduce the number of permanently open aisles by creating access only where needed. Floor condition, load information, operating clearance, manufacturer requirements, and access controls should be confirmed before installation.

How We Coordinate Warehouse Shelving Installation in Joliet

Installation is planned around the approved scope, component delivery, access windows, staging space, and the facility’s inbound and outbound schedule. Early coordination helps prevent missing parts, blocked work areas, and installation activity from interfering with active operations.

Step 1 - Map Inventory Movement and Current Congestion

We review what enters the building, where it is checked, how reserve stock is replenished, which items are picked most often, and where materials are needed next. Photos, quantities, dimensions, weights, and workflow notes help define the priority.

Step 2 - Verify the Layout, Components, and Work Area

Before assembly, we confirm room dimensions, shelving quantities, shelf levels, doors, columns, utilities, aisle spacing, delivery paths, staging locations, and customer-supplied component condition. Manufacturer information and the approved configuration should be available for reference.

Step 3 - Install by Zone and Operating Sequence

The crew stages components, assembles units, aligns rows, and positions shelving in the agreed order. When the scope allows, the work can be divided by aisle, room, department, or shift so other portions of the facility remain available.

Step 4 - Review the Installed Scope Before Loading

We walk the completed area with the facility representative and confirm the installation scope. The customer can then coordinate labels, inventory placement, loading practices, replenishment rules, and ongoing inspection procedures.

Maintain Clear Aisles, Stable Storage, and Published Capacity

OSHA requires aisles and passageways used with mechanical handling equipment to provide sufficient clearance and remain clear, while stored materials must be stable and secure. Warehousing guidance also emphasizes good housekeeping, proper storage practices, and attention to damaged or unsafe equipment.

JC Installations Services LLC focuses on assembly, alignment, access, and the approved shelving configuration. After handoff, the facility remains responsible for loading, inspections, housekeeping, employee procedures, and site-specific compliance decisions. Published manufacturer capacities should never be exceeded.

Signs Your Joliet Facility Needs a Better Shelving Plan

A new installation or planned reconfiguration may be appropriate when:

  • Inbound cartons remain on the dock because permanent storage locations are unavailable.
  • Reserve inventory and daily pick stock are mixed in the same crowded locations.
  • Replenishment repeatedly crosses shipping, production, or forklift travel paths.
  • Small parts, tools, or supplies are stored in open boxes without consistent labels.
  • Returns, damaged goods, and inspection holds compete with sellable inventory for space.
  • Employees move several cartons to reach the item that is actually needed.
  • New contracts, SKUs, or seasonal volume have outgrown the original storage layout.
  • Existing shelving is bent, incomplete, unstable, mixed, or unsuitable for the intended load.

Can shelving installation be completed inside an active Joliet distribution facility?

Many projects can be divided by aisle, room, department, or shift while other areas remain active. The facility should identify required travel paths, clear each work zone, provide staging space, and coordinate receiving and shipping windows before the crew arrives.
